Restricted Stock Units (RSUs)

Restricted Stock Units (RSUs) are a form of equity compensation given to employees as part of their overall compensation package. RSUs represent a promise by the employer to grant a certain number of shares of company stock to the employee at a future date, once certain conditions are met.

Key Points:

  • RSUs are a popular form of equity compensation used by many companies to attract and retain top talent.
  • Unlike stock options, RSUs do not require the employee to purchase the stock at a set price.
  • RSUs typically have vesting schedules that determine when the employee will receive the shares.
  • Once the shares vest, the employee can sell them or hold onto them, depending on their financial goals.

    Why Choose RSUs?
    RSUs are often preferred by employees because they provide a sense of ownership in the company without the financial risk associated with stock options. Additionally, RSUs can align the interests of employees with those of shareholders, as the value of the RSUs is tied to the performance of the company’s stock.
